## Configuration — HueGuard contrast audit

Support team: HueGuard reads settings from `.env` at startup. `HG_STANDARD` selects WCAG level (AA default), `HG_SITEMAP` points to the customer's page list, and reports export to `HG_OUTPUT_DIR`. Restart the auditor after edits. Uploading results to the Pellam dashboard requires an API token, which goes on the next line.

env line for fafof-fahag: LEDGER_TOKEN5=f8790

# Settings note – cron drift investigation (Ledgermoth batch)
# The nightly rollup has been firing 4–7 minutes late since the last
# release. We suspect the scheduler host clock, not the job itself.
# Do not change the cron expression until drift is confirmed; the
# downstream reconciler tolerates up to 10 minutes. To inspect the
# job-history table yourself, use the connection string below.

replica DSN, kajep-yahag: mssql://praok_svc:iF@db-8d68.plorvaio.local:5432/eliion

**Q: Why did Tidybranch delete a branch someone was still using?**

A: Tidybranch flags branches with no commits in 90 days and deletes them after a 14-day warning posted on the merge request. Branches matching the protected patterns in the repo config are skipped. Deleted branches can be restored within 30 days from the bot's archive log. To request a restore or add a protection pattern, contact the tooling team here.

escalation mailbox, bafog-fafog: ulador@paliqlabs.internal